Cyndeo Wealth Partners LLC lifted its position in shares of EPR Properties (NYSE:EPR - Free Report) by 4.2% during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 161,474 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ock after purchasing an additional 6,520 shares during the period. Cyndeo Wealth Partners LLC owned 0.21% of EPR Properties worth $9,407,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

EPR Properties Price Performance
Shares of NYSE EPR opened at $54.33 on Friday. EPR Properties has a twelve month low of $41.75 and a twelve month high of $61.24.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$55.10 and a 200 day simple moving average of $54.33. The company has a market capitalization of $4.14 billion, a PE ratio of 26.76, a P/E/G ratio of 3.83 and a beta of 1.28. The company has a quick ratio of 7.77, a current ratio of 7.77 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.20.
EPR Properties (NYSE:EPR -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The real estate investment trust reported $1.24 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$1.25 by ($0.01). The firm had revenue of $150.35 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$176.50 million. EPR Properties had a return on equity of 7.66% and a net margin of 25.28%.EPR Properties's quarterly revenue was up 3.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$1.22 EPS. EPR Properties has set its FY 2025 guidance at 5.000-5.160 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that EPR Properties will post 4.65 EPS for the current year.

About EPR Properties

EPR Properties NYSE: EPR is the leading diversified experiential net lease real estate investment trust (REIT), specializing in select enduring experiential properties in the real estate industry. We focus on real estate venues that create value by facilitating out of home leisure and recreation experiences where consumers choose to spend their discretionary time and money.
